The design of a website or mobile application plays a pivotal role in attracting and retaining users. It’s not just about aesthetics; it’s about creating a seamless and enjoyable user experience. To achieve this, designers follow a set of UI/UX principles that serve as the foundation of exceptional design. In this blog, we will delve into these principles and how they can be optimized to create a user-centric, visually appealing interface.
The Importance of UI/UX Principles
Before we dive into the specific UI/UX principles, it’s crucial to understand why they are so important. In a world where users have countless options at their fingertips, your design can make or break their experience. Here are a few reasons why UI/UX principles are vital:
A well-designed user interface and experience result in higher user satisfaction. When users enjoy using your product, they are more likely to return and recommend it to others.
Engaging designs keep users on your platform longer, which can lead to increased conversion rates and revenue.
A user-friendly design ensures that users can easily navigate and accomplish their tasks without frustration.
A polished design reflects positively on your brand, instilling trust and credibility.
In a crowded marketplace, exceptional design can set you apart from the competition.
UI/UX Principles: The Building Blocks
1. User-Centered Design
The foundation of UI/UX principles lies in understanding your users. User-centered design involves research, empathy, and constant feedback. To optimize this principle, regularly gather user data and incorporate it into your design decisions. Conduct user interviews and surveys to get valuable insights into their needs and preferences.
2. Consistency is Key
Consistency in design creates a sense of familiarity and predictability. It ensures that users can easily find their way around your product. Maintain consistency in colors, typography, and layout to optimize this principle. Create a style guide or design system to keep your visual elements uniform.
3. Intuitive Navigation
Navigation should be intuitive and straightforward. Users shouldn’t have to guess where to find information or how to perform actions. Use clear labels, logical grouping, and visual cues to guide users effectively. Conduct usability testing to identify and address navigation issues.
4. Responsive Design
In today’s multi-device world, responsive design is essential. Ensure that your UI/UX adapts seamlessly to different screen sizes and orientations. Mobile responsiveness is a must to optimize this principle. Test your design on various devices and use media queries to ensure a responsive layout.
5. Visual Hierarchy
Visual hierarchy helps users understand the importance and relationships of different elements on a page. Use techniques like size, color, and placement to guide users’ attention to key information. Conduct eye-tracking studies to fine-tune your design’s visual hierarchy.
Inclusive design is crucial. Ensure that your UI/UX is accessible to all users, including those with disabilities. This involves using proper alt text for images, providing keyboard navigation, and other accessible features. Regularly audit your design for accessibility compliance and involve users with disabilities in testing.
7. Loading Speed
A slow-loading website can deter users. To optimize this principle, focus on optimizing images, minimizing scripts, and leveraging content delivery networks (CDNs) for faster load times. Use tools like PageSpeed Insights to analyze and improve your website’s loading speed.
8. Feedback and Affordance
Users should receive feedback when they perform an action. Buttons should look clickable, and form fields should be clearly identifiable. Feedback and affordance make interactions feel natural. Conduct usability testing to ensure that users receive appropriate feedback during their interactions.
9. Minimize Cognitive Load
Don’t overwhelm users with too much information or too many choices. Simplify the user journey and streamline the decision-making process. Conduct user testing to identify points of cognitive overload and simplify complex processes.
10. Testing and Iteration
Continuous improvement is key to exceptional design. Regularly test your design with real users and gather feedback. Use this information to iterate and refine your UI/UX. A/B testing, heatmaps, and user analytics can provide valuable data for ongoing optimization.
Exceptional design is not a one-time effort but an ongoing journey. By adhering to the core UI/UX principles outlined above, you can create a user-friendly, engaging, and visually appealing design that sets your brand apart. Remember, the user should always be at the center of your design decisions. Stay updated with the latest trends and technologies, and never stop iterating. Your commitment to UI/UX principles will pay off in the form of satisfied users and a successful digital presence. Whether you’re a seasoned designer or just starting, these principles can guide you toward crafting extraordinary user experiences. Elevate your design, delight your users, and watch your digital presence flourish.